Rotary Paddle
This insertable two-vane collapsible paddle can be used with Safepoint failsafe and Model KA/KAX rotary-paddle level switches. It has a turning diameter of 8.66 in., and can be used with level switches that are mounted vertically or horizontally. The paddle may be inserted from the outside of a bin or silo through a 1-1/4-in. NPT or 1-1/2-in. BSPT coupling. A spring-action feature allows the paddle to be removed, if necessary.

VibraRod high-level indicator
The VibraRod high-level indicator can handle bulk solids with densities as low as 3.12 lbs/ft3 (0.05 kg/dm3) and particle sizes up to 0.375 in. (9.5 mm). This sensor has a universal power supply (20–255-V AC/DC), allowing customers with various power supply requirements to specify a single part number for all of their different voltage requirements. The indicator’s single-element probe requires no calibration, and is available in a variety of configurations. This design helps eliminate false signals that typically exist when material builds up between the tines of tuning-fork-style probes. In addition, the vibrating action of the VibraRod tends to self-clean the probe of most materials. The standard length of the inserted portion of the probe is approximately 8 in. (203 mm). Pipe and cable extension units are available for longer lengths in top-mounted applications.

Flexar guided-wave radar level measurement system
The Flexar guided-wave radar level measurement system uses proven time-domain reflectometry (TDR) technology. It is used in a wide assortment of vessels and industries for measuring levels up to 200 ft (60m) in height. The Flexar sensor requires no field calibration or re-calibration and can be easily set up without the use of any special tools or training. Flexar units are suited for almost any application, can operate with process temperatures up to 392°F (200°C), can be provided with a variety of process connections and can work reliably with materials having a wide range of bulk densities and dielectric constants.
